Ok, so you are referring to having the pages available while offline, then?

When you bookmarked the page, you have the option to make content available offline.

Even afterwards you can, In IE go to Favorites, Organise Favorites.

Click on the link, and in the bottome right of the screen, there is an option to make available offline put a tick in it and then click the Properties button that will appear. you can set depth of site to download, as well as Synchronse options.

If this is not what you are looking for, but want to check that the link you have is a valid link, then you will have to click each seperate link to verify it, or use a download program that will automate the task for you.
